Multi-stage evidence-grounded inference architecture replacing the monolithic 9B model extraction pipeline. CPU-first specialist services handle routine extraction while the 9B vLLM model is preserved for semantic adjudication of ambiguous cases. Key components: - Capability-aware inference gateway (OpenAI-compatible + Ollama) - Endpoint registry with DB migrations and REST API - Sentence-aware document segmenter (property tests) - Deterministic financial parsing with offset integrity - Symbol resolution with ambiguity detection - Specialist service (GLiNER2, dynamic batching, K8s deployment) - Company-specific sentiment (FinBERT, calibration) - Retrieval-based novelty and duplicate detection - Confidence calibration pipeline - Deterministic routing engine (property tests) - 9B adjudication layer with VRAM gating - Stock-specific impact model (features, labels, baseline, trained) - Pipeline orchestrator (state machine, queues, leases, feature flags) - Bounded parallelism (async workers, semaphore, load shedding) - Observability (tracing, metrics, alerts) - Compatibility adapter (v3→v2 golden mapping tests) - Shadow/canary promotion framework - Active learning and fine-tuning pipeline Test results: 1,161 tests pass, ruff lint clean. All 282 spec tasks completed.
